Product Details of [ 2039-50-1 ]

CAS No. :2039-50-1
Formula : C10H8BrNO
M.W : 238.08
SMILES Code : BrCC1=CC(C2=CC=CC=C2)=NO1
MDL No. :MFCD00159724

YieldReaction ConditionsOperation in experiment
55.2% With phosphorus tribromide; In diethyl ether; at 20℃; [00230j (3-Phenylisoxazol-5-yl)methanol (2.0 g, 11 mmol) and phosphorus tribromide (1.1 ml, 11 mmol) in ether (30 mL) were stirred overnight at rt. The solution waspartitioned between water/brine and ether. The organic layer was filtered through silica and concentrated to furnish Example 14A (1.5 g, 6.30 mmol, 55.2% yield) as a white solid. 1H NMR (500 MHz, CD3OD) oe 7.83 (dd, J=7.8, 1.8 Hz, 2H), 7.58 - 7.40 (m, 3H), 6.88 (s, 1H), 4.55 (s, 2H).
With phosphorus tribromide; In dichloromethane; at 0℃;Cooling with ice; General procedure: A mixture of b' (10 mmol) in anhydrous CH2Cl2 (25 mL) was cooled to 0 C, a solution of PBr3 (0.95 mL, 10 mmol) in CH2Cl2 (2 mL) was added dropwise and stirred in ice-bath until the raw material consumed. When warmed up to room temperature, the reaction mixture was neutralized with 10% NaOH and extracted with CH2Cl2 two times, The organic phase was evaporated under reduced pressure and purified by silica gel chromatography with petroleum ether/ethyl acetate to give c'.
